997 Carrera GTS - some interesting performance figures you may not know
Carrera GTS Coupe
Manual: 0-100 kph in 4.6 sec.
0-200 kph in 14.8 sec.
PDK with Sport Chrono Plus:
0-100 kph in 4.2 sec.
0-200 kph in 14.1 sec.
Carrera GTS Cabriolet
Manual: 0-100 kph in 4.8 sec.
0-200 kph in 15.7 sec.
PDK with Sport Chrono Plus:
0-100 kph in 4.4 sec.
0-200 kph in 15.0 sec.
For comparison:
911 Speedster
0-100 kph in 4.4 sec.
0-200 kph in 15.0 sec.
Identical to GTS Cabriolet with PDK and Sport Chrono Plus !
Carrera S
Manual: 0-100 kph in 4.7 sec.
0-200 kph in 15.2 sec.
PDK with Sport Chrono Plus:
0-100 kph in 4.5 sec.
0-200 kph in 14.8 sec.
Carrera S Cabriolet
Manual: 0-100 kph in 4.9 sec.
0-200 kph in 16.1 sec.
PDK with Sport Chrono Plus:
0-100 kph in 4.7 sec.
0-200 kph in 15.7 sec.
Carrera
Manual: 0-100 kph in 4.9 sec.
0-200 kph in 16.6 sec.
PDK with Sport Chrono Plus:
0-100 kph in 4.7 sec.
0-200 kph in 16.3 sec.
Carrera Cabriolet
Manual: 0-100 kph in 5.1 sec.
0-200 kph in 17.5 sec.
PDK with Sport Chrono Plus:
0-100 kph in 4.9 sec.
0-200 kph in 17.2 sec.
The biggest differences:
A Carrera GTS Coupe PDK is 0.7 sec. faster from 0-100 kph and 2.5 sec. faster from 0-200 kph than a Carrera Coupe with manual.
Same performance difference between Carrera GTS Cabriolet PDK and Carrera Cabriolet manual.
Meaning: There is a difference in performance compared to the Carrera base models but compared to the Carrera S, the difference is marginal.
While the GTS is still a bargain from many aspects, the very small performance difference actually doesn't make the Carrera Powerkit a good deal. One reason maybe why it doesn't seem to be available anymore for order on a new car, at least not in Germany.
